The GME XRS-375C is a MIL-STD 810H rated heavy duty compact UHF CB radio delivering 5 watts of output power with Bluetooth audio and data connectivity, a built-in GPS receiver, and 12/24 volt power input for compatibility with both light vehicles and 24V heavy commercial trucks. The included MC670B professional-grade speaker microphone carries an IP67 rating for dust and water resistance.
The XRS-375C is GME's heavy duty compact UHF CB radio, engineered for professional operators and demanding 4WD, commercial, and worksite environments where standard consumer equipment falls short. MIL-STD 810H certification covers vibration, mechanical shock, temperature extremes, and humidity resistance, making this one of the most ruggedised compact UHF CB radios available for Australian mining, agriculture, heavy transport, and serious 4WD applications.
The 12/24 volt power input installs directly into both 12V light vehicles and 24V heavy commercial trucks and machinery without voltage converters or additional power management hardware, covering an entire mixed-voltage fleet from a single radio platform. The wired PPT input connects an external push-to-talk switch for hands-free key-up in heavy machinery, trucks, and off-road vehicles where keeping both hands on the wheel is essential.
The XRS Connect smartphone app pairs via Bluetooth to add Voice Playback, Active Mute, Crewtalk, and Location Services using the radio's built-in GPS receiver. The radio operates as a fully functional UHF CB unit independently of any paired smartphone. Bluetooth and the app extend capability when connected but are not required for standard UHF CB operation. Scansuite digital scanning monitors multiple channels simultaneously. Noise Reduction Technology filters background interference on transmit and receive. Automatic Power Down protects the vehicle battery during extended stops.

What does MIL-STD 810H mean and why does it matter? MIL-STD 810H is a US military standard defining a series of environmental and mechanical tests covering vibration, shock, temperature extremes, and humidity resistance. A radio certified to this standard has been tested to withstand conditions significantly beyond normal consumer use, making the XRS-375C suitable for mining, agriculture, heavy transport, and serious 4WD applications where equipment faces constant physical stress.
How is the XRS-375C different from the XRS-335C? The XRS-375C adds MIL-STD 810H ruggedisation, 12/24 volt power input for heavy commercial vehicle compatibility, and a wired PPT input for external push-to-talk accessories. Operators in demanding environments or running 24V vehicle fleets should select the XRS-375C. The XRS-335C suits standard 12V passenger and 4WD applications where the additional ruggedisation is not required.
What is the wired PPT input used for? The wired PPT input connects an external push-to-talk switch to the radio, enabling hands-free key-up without pressing the microphone button. This is particularly useful for operators in heavy machinery, trucks, or off-road vehicles who need to maintain full hand and control contact while communicating.
Does the XRS-375C work in 24V trucks and heavy vehicles? Yes. The 12/24 volt power input connects directly to both 12V light vehicle and 24V heavy commercial electrical systems without requiring additional voltage conversion hardware, making it suitable for use across mixed light and heavy vehicle fleets.
